Feels appropriate to post a reflection on the final day of this update, so here goes:

The second iteration of the concealed maneuvers was an abject failure. By day 2, there were at least 3 bots on each team, and most matches did not even feature 1 CV (human or bot). Apparently the "silent majority" had enough after the first iteration and said no thank you to double CV presence in a 9 v 9 game mode.

Not sure how much useful data WG will collect, but they may be holding back on introducing mines if the latest devblog is any indication. The new CVs Yorktown and Essex will have the smokescreen consumable (tested on the IJN carriers): https://blog.worldofwarships.com/blog/476

The trade-in feature was in-line with expectations, for once. The doubloon values for trading in ships matched exactly what was previewed in the devblogs, a flat 50% rate, so good on WG for not publishing misinformation. For veteran players like myself with a large stockpile of coal, the event may even be considered a win-win as one could trade in a Forrest Sherman (the cheapest T10 coal ship), get a free T8, rebuy the Sherman, and possibly repeat the process again. In turn, the "excess" supply of coal is reduced which WG has acknowledged is a goal they are actively seeking. 

This by the way, is a much more constructive and acceptable method to reduce resource stockpiles, as compared to the underhanded tactics when they changed the supercontainer and anniversary rewards.
